Output d63c31c31ef46265a4a6ff6dc13fd067f273bf2d137a5c2c88cf9f2c9850b46a:3

value
74163375
script pubkey
OP_0 OP_PUSHBYTES_32 c99928af68a21bf15eff47124777b746612e145c8861e7a61ce1640bf0837886
address
bc1qexvj3tmg5gdlzhhlgufywaahgesju9zu3ps70fsuu9jqhuyr0zrqwsjfh7
transaction
d63c31c31ef46265a4a6ff6dc13fd067f273bf2d137a5c2c88cf9f2c9850b46a
confirmations
89593
spent
true